Studies on Calli Liquid Culture and Plant Regeneration of Konjac

Abstract: :The granular calli of konjac was employed for study of liquid culture and plant regeneration.The results showed that MS +BA 1.0 mg/L +2, 4-D 0.2 mg/L + sugar 30g/L + agar 6.0 g/L couldefficiently induce granularcalli from the bud.Obtained calli were cut about 0.3 cm and then subsequently cultured in MS +BA 0.05mg/L+NAA 0.1 mg/L+sugar 30 g/L +PVP(PolyVinyl-Pyrrolidone)1.0 g/L for establishing liquid culture system.The growth of liquid culture material showed a parabola curve, the weight gain for more than 80% of entire culture period from the sixth day to the twelfth day.In addition, pH value of medium increased during the culture process.The material that was cultured twelve days turned to 1/2MS +BA 0.6 mg/L +NAA 0.1 mg/L +glucose 30 g/L +vitamin C100 mg/L +agar 6.0 g/L for differentiation culture.Big buds that the leaf expects were cut and put on 1/2MS + +NAA 0.1 mg/L + sugar 30 g/L+agar 6.0 g/L for inducing root, eventually the regenerative plantlets were formed.
